> When you set up your server to be bound to IPv6 (but you don't bind the management port to anything), the server fails to stop. Second attempt will force the server to stop.
> This is the error in the log:
> {code}
> !ENTRY org.eclipse.wst.server.core 4 0 2012-07-02 16:49:05.284
> !MESSAGE Server jboss-eap-6.0.0.GA failed to stop.
> {code}
> This happens most probably because in such scenario, the management port is bound to IPv4 localhost (127.0.0.1).
> Indeed I just verified that this is not related to IPv6 specifically but any host name other than localhost - if you don't check "Expose your management port" (and don't set -Dmanagement manually) and the hostname is something else than localhost, then this issue will arise. Note that with remote servers you don't need to bind the management port to anything for server stop to work. So we either need to set -Dmanagement always or make sure it is not needed.
